Understanding Wireless Charging
Wireless charging is a technology that allows you to charge your devices without the need for cables. It works by using electromagnetic fields to transfer energy between a transmitter (the charger) and a receiver (the device). This technology is based on the Qi (pronounced “chee”) wireless charging standard, which is widely supported by most modern smartphones and devices.

Can I use a RAM Wireless Charger with a phone case or accessory?
In general, you can use a RAM Wireless Charger with a phone case or accessory, but it depends on the type and thickness of the case. Thicker cases or those with metal or magnetic materials may interfere with wireless charging. It’s recommended to remove any cases or accessories before charging or check the manufacturer’s guidelines for compatibility. Some RAM Wireless Chargers may also come with specific recommendations or guidelines for using cases or accessories with wireless charging.
